In the previous section, we saw how easy it's to work with Hyperledger Composer using Playground. Now we'll install Composer in your own (local) machine.
We'll start with the three most important stages of installing a blockchain network:
- Installing the prerequisites
- Installing Hyperledger Composer (the development environment)
- Updating the environment
We can install the blockchain network using Hyperledger Fabric by many means, including local servers, Kubernetes,IBM Cloud, and Docker. To begin with, we'll explore Docker and Kubernetes.
Docker can be installed using information provided on https://www.docker.com/get-started.
Hyperledger Composer works with two versions of Docker:
- Docker Composer version 1.8 or higher
- Docker Engine version 17.03 or higher
